COLOMBO (News 1st); The Seethawaka Odyssey special weekend train service will commence operations from Sunday, 26th February 2023.

The special luxury weekend train service is powered by a S-12 Power Set, and can accommodate a total of 250 passengers.

It includes 2 air-conditioned compartments with 44 seats each, and another two compartments with 44 second-class seats each.

It also includes another compartment with 47 third-class seats.

The train is expected to leave Fort, Colombo at 7:15 AM on every Sunday, and is expected to reach Avissawella at 9:35 AM.

Thereafter, the train will commence its return journey from Avissawella at 17:25 the same day, and is expected to reach Colombo at 20:30.

Ticket fares are as follows:

1st Class (Reserved): Rs. 500/- for one-way trip, Rs. 800/- with return trip.

2nd Class (Reserved): Rs. 300/- for one-way trip, Rs. 500/- with return trip.

3rd Class (Reserved): Rs. 200/- for one-way trip, Rs. 350/- with return trip.

A statement from Sri Lanka Railways said that the Western Province Tourism Board had decided to station normal & air-conditioned buses at the Waga Train Station to allow passengers to visit attractions in the area.
